Tender Title: Xenon Short Arc Lamp Power Supply
Tender Reference Number: GEM/2025/B/6101446
Issuing Authority/Department: Department of Space
The Department of Space invites bids for the procurement of Xenon Short Arc Lamp Power Supply as detailed in the attached specifications. This tender aims to source two units of this high-performance power supply, designed to meet rigorous operational standards for various applications.

To participate in this tender, bidders should complete the registration process on the relevant government e-marketplace (GEM) portal. This typically involves filling out necessary forms, submitting requisite documents, and ensuring all submitted materials are in accepted formats, such as PDF or Word documents.
The Earnest Money Deposit (EMD) amount will be specified in the tender documentation. Bidders are required to submit the EMD as part of their financial proposal to show their commitment to participating in the tender process, ensuring that only serious bids are considered.
MSEs may receive special consideration during the evaluation process, including benefits such as reduced EMD requirements and potential preference in scoring. These provisions aim to enhance participation from small-scale businesses and encourage local entrepreneurs within the regulatory frameworks established by the government.
